I would like to have your thoughts on Cadmium analysis using 8900. 

I ran Cd in He mode using mass 111 but I also analysed Cd in O2 mode, but without a mass shift. The latest was probably a pre-set from one of the pre-set method in massHunter... 

Between the two modes, my QC looks better with O2 even if not in mass shift (I read somewhere that most of the time, O2 is used in mass shift).

  • I don't know what is sensitivity in He mode, probably it's the same like in O2 mode. I use He mode for polyatomic ions ( masses between 40-90) so there no need of He for Cd 111. But if you use only He mode, you can use it also for cadmium. If more sensitivity is needed you must add no gas mode. If there some interferences you can use O2 mode. I regularly use O2 mode for arsenic, so it's no problem to add one more element (Cd).
